New homes in Abbots Langley

Situated in the South East, Abbots Langley is a large village in Hertfordshire. Close to Hemel Hempstead and St Albans, trains to London from neighbouring Watford take just 20 minutes, meaning houses in Abbots Langley could be an option if you work in the English capital.

When it comes to your spare time, you can take advantage of Leavesden Country Park on the edge of town or Longspring Wood just the other side of the M25 to the north. Don’t miss the Warner Bros. Studios if you love your films either, once you pick from our new builds closest to Abbots Langley below.
